From Vulnerability Discovery To Continuous Exposure Management: A Framework For Defending At Machine Speed
The era of vulnerability scanning as a defense strategy is over. AI native scanners have made discovery cheap and fast—too fast for traditional patching cycles to keep pace. The speed of discovery has outpaced the speed of remediation by an order of magnitude. And that asymmetry is where modern attacks live.
Armis Labs has investigated how the world’s most resilient organizations are adapting to this shift, and what we’ve found is a move away from “scanning and patching” toward continuous exposure management—a model where discovery, prioritization, and remediation are woven together into a single feedback loop. It’s not about finding more or patching faster. It’s about building systems that understand your environment deeply enough to make intelligent decisions at machine speed.
